From ef6e60fd111080a25c6e0d0100ac8d25ec0f3b96 Mon Sep 17 00:00:00 2001 From: Sainan <63328889+Sainan@users.noreply.github.com> Date: Wed, 2 Jul 2025 23:25:33 +0200 Subject: [PATCH 1/2] fix: always apply negative standing cap --- src/services/inventoryService.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/services/inventoryService.ts b/src/services/inventoryService.ts index 69299ec8..b2aa48dc 100644 --- a/src/services/inventoryService.ts +++ b/src/services/inventoryService.ts @@ -1266,7 +1266,7 @@ export const addStanding = ( const max = getMaxStanding(syndicateMeta, syndicate.Title ?? 0); if (syndicate.Standing + gainedStanding > max) gainedStanding = max - syndicate.Standing; - if (syndicate.Title == -2 && syndicate.Standing + gainedStanding < -71000) { + if (syndicate.Standing + gainedStanding < -71000) { gainedStanding = -71000 + syndicate.Standing; } -- 2.47.2 From 1df5153a77b2753951a50f49ca59b07d01718194 Mon Sep 17 00:00:00 2001 From: Sainan <63328889+Sainan@users.noreply.github.com> Date: Thu, 3 Jul 2025 01:49:13 +0200 Subject: [PATCH 2/2] fix operation --- src/services/inventoryService.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/services/inventoryService.ts b/src/services/inventoryService.ts index b2aa48dc..68e6b7cc 100644 --- a/src/services/inventoryService.ts +++ b/src/services/inventoryService.ts @@ -1267,7 +1267,7 @@ export const addStanding = ( if (syndicate.Standing + gainedStanding > max) gainedStanding = max - syndicate.Standing; if (syndicate.Standing + gainedStanding < -71000) { - gainedStanding = -71000 + syndicate.Standing; + gainedStanding = -71000 - syndicate.Standing; } if (!isMedallion || syndicateMeta.medallionsCappedByDailyLimit) { -- 2.47.2